Obituary for Annette E. Miles (Briggs)

HAMPDEN – Annette E. Miles, 77, wife of 57 years to Arthur Miles, passed away on Jan 22, 2018 after an unexpected and brief illness. She was born on March 28, 1940 in Bradford, ME, and was the daughter of Ted and Rose Briggs. She graduated from Old Town High School in 1958 and went on to attend the 1961 inaugural class of the University of Maine’s Nursing School. Annette started her career at St. Joseph’s Hospital before she and the love of her life Artie, raised their adoring sons. She later balanced work and family working as the school nurse where the boys attended before returning to OB/GYN at EMMC. Here she helped nurture a generation of babies into the world and retired after 19 years. Annette’s passions were her family and friends, her gardens, knitting, and her love for the coast of Maine. She always accommodated others first and was so very generous with love and compassion; wanting no recognition for her efforts. Her friendships were many and she always took time to keep in touch; high school friends, work associates made throughout her career, and countless dear and close friends. She will be greatly missed by many. Annette is survived by her loving husband, Arthur of Hampden, mother Rose Briggs of Brewer, sister Paula Hurt of Olathe, KS, son Glenn and wife Cheryl, grandchildren Alysha and Justin of Standish, son Joel and his wife Beth of Punta Gorda, FL, and cousin Susan Schultz of Spartanburg, SC.
